Masonic lodges are not evil and do not engage in devil worship.
Chief ranger Cameron Coombs from the court of Western Star sought to “erase” that popular perception yesterday, during its 166th anniversary service at the St Leonard’s Anglican Church.
“Let me say that no atheist can become a member of our society. And furthermore, that our teachings are derived from and based on The Bible. We therefore share with you, a common Christian faith rooted in the fatherhood of God and the brotherhood of man,” Coombs explained.  
The Order of Foresters and Friendly Societies, from which Western Star is derived, was started around 1790 in England and came to Barbados in 1846, making the local arm one of the oldest in the world. There are three subordinate courts in Barbados.
